Unpacking the Global Craze The Labubu phenomenon didn't happen in a vacuum. It was a perfect storm of unique design and incredible exposure. When an artist with a colossal social media following like Lisa posts a photo, it acts as a massive signal to her millions of fans. This celebrity endorsement created a buying frenzy, with scenes at Pop Mart stores in the US and Europe rivaling an iPhone launch. This intense demand, fueled by limited releases, instantly created a lucrative second market where prices for rare pieces soared. It's a fascinating example of modern designer toy culture, where a physical item's value is amplified by its digital presence. It's not just fans paying attention; Wall Street is, too, with the parent company's stock showing incredible growth. The Resale Market Explained One of the most talked-about aspects of Labubu is its price. On the secondary market, a rare, hidden-figure labubu outfit can sell for 30 times its original price. In the high-end art world, a life-sized Labubu statue even sold at auction for over $150,000! For the average collector, this doesn't mean you should expect to get rich. Rather, it indicates that the pieces have a strong perceived value. This high demand means that a well-cared-for collection will likely retain its value, making it a relatively safe and enjoyable hobby to invest your time and money in. Who is Buying All This Labubu Clothing? A Look at the Community If you're diving into this hobby, you're in good company. The community is a huge part of the fun. Collectors are primarily Gen Z and young millennials (ages 15-35), with women making up about 65% of the consumer base. For many, collecting is more than just buying; it's a way to connect. You can read more about our story on our About Us page.   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) 1. What is the best type of outfit to start my collection with? We recommend starting with a versatile two-piece set, like a simple t-shirt and overalls or a top and skirt. This gives you immediate mix-and-match potential as you add more pieces to your collection. 2. How do I care for my Labubu doll clothes to keep them looking new? For most cotton or handmade items, gentle hand-washing with a mild soap and air-drying is best. Store them in a small, dust-free box or a miniature wardrobe to prevent fading and damage. 3. Are the more expensive "limited edition" outfits worth it for a new collector? For a brand new collector, it's often better to focus on building a versatile base wardrobe first. Limited edition pieces are exciting, but they can be expensive and may not be easy to style with other items. Building a collection that feels authentic to you requires a bit of knowledge. Let's break down the essentials. H3: Understanding the Fit: The 17cm Standard First things first: size matters. The vast majority of Labubu doll clothes are designed for the standard 17cm (approx. 6.7 inches) doll. This uniformity is a blessing for collectors, as it creates a standardized market. Key Search Term: You'll often see handmade labubu clothes for 17cm dolls online. This is the magic phrase to find unique, custom pieces from independent artists. Fit and Articulation: A well-made labubu outfit won't just look good; it will allow for proper posing and articulation, which is crucial for photography and display. H3: Decoding Materials: A No-Nonsense Guide for Men The texture and quality of the fabric are what separate a basic outfit from a collector's piece. Here’s what to look for, framed in terms you'll appreciate: Durable Cottons & Denims: Think of these as your classic raw denim jeans or a sturdy workshirt. They are reliable, look better with age, and are perfect for everyday, casual labubu clothing. Technical Fabrics: Think nylon, ripstop, and other performance materials often seen in modern outerwear. These give off a tech-wear or "gorpcore" vibe that's very current in men's fashion. For insights on quality gear, Gear Patrol is a great resource. Wools & Knits: This is your classic heritage menswear. A tiny, well-made knit sweater or woolen overcoat has a timeless appeal and adds a touch of sophistication to your collection. Premium Leathers & Suedes: These are the grail-level materials, often found on limited-edition jackets or accessories. They signal ultimate luxury and craftsmanship.
